r <br /> r <br /> 9. 07 BACKFLOW PREVENTERS <br /> All backflow preventers shall be mounted aboveground , in non-traffic r <br /> areas on the customer's side of the meter. Aboveground piping shall be <br /> ductile iron . Brass or Copper pipe may be used for pipe 2" in diameter or <br /> smaller. Backflow preventers shall be of reduced pressure/double check r <br /> type with two (2) independently operating check valves , and shall be <br /> designed to operate in a horizontal flow mode . An independent relief <br /> valve shall be located between the two check valves. Reduced pressure <br /> feature shall be included in all commerical applications . Preventers shall <br /> be University of Southern California ( USC) approved as per the Approved <br /> Manufacturer's Product List. <br /> r <br /> 9.08 VALVE BOXES <br /> A . All buried valves shall have cast iron two or three-piece valve r <br /> boxes with cast iron covers . Valve boxes shall be provided with <br /> suitable heavy bonnets and extend to match finished grade <br /> surface as directed by the Engineer. The barrel shall be one or <br /> two-piece , screw type, having 5Ya' shaft. Covers shall have <br /> "WATER" cast into the top for all water mains, "SEWER" cast into <br /> the top for all wastewater force mains and 'REUSE" cast into the r <br /> top for all reuse mains All valves shall have actuating nuts <br /> extended to within 24 inches of the top of the valve box cover. <br /> r <br /> B . Valve boxes shall be provided with concrete base and valve <br /> nameplate, with suitable anchors for casting in concrete . <br /> Nameplate shall be 3" diameter bronze disk with engraved r <br /> lettering 1 /8" deep , as shown on the Drawings and manufactured <br /> per the Approved Manufacturer' s Product List. <br /> C . Valve boxes shall be installed in a concrete pad , as specified in <br /> Drawing Detail M-5. IRCDUS may eliminate concrete pad in <br /> asphalt pavement. <br /> 9 .09 CORPORATION STOPS <br /> r <br /> A . Corporation stops for connections to ductile iron or P. V. C. piping <br /> shall be all brass or bronze suitable for 150 psi operating pressure , <br /> shall be iron pipe or AWWA tapered thread design , shall be as per the . , <br /> Approved Manufacturer's Product List, and shall be of sizes required <br /> and/or noted on the Drawings . <br /> r <br /> B . Saddles shall be stainless steel double strap with epoxy coated iron <br /> saddle as per the Approved Manufacturer's Product List. <br /> r <br /> 9 - 4 <br />
